Sigrid Heuck (born May 11, 1932 in Cologne ; † October 2, 2014 in Bad Tölz ) was a German writer and illustrator .

Sigrid Heuck grew up on her mother's pony farm in a town on Bergstrasse ; from 1949 she lived in the Grabenmühle, a historic building in Upper Bavaria near Dietramszell - Rampertshofen . Sigrid Heuck attended a fashion school in Munich from 1949 ; she then completed a degree in commercial graphics at the Munich Academy of Fine Arts . She worked for various advertising agencies , but then moved to the illustrating of children's books . Since 1959 she has been a freelance writer and illustrator.

Sigrid Heuck's extensive work includes illustrations for his own and others' picture book texts, and narrative works for children and young people . While her children's books are strongly influenced by the author's closeness to nature - who also wrote a number of titles from the horse book genre - her youth books are partly about fantastic literature (Said's story) , adventure literature (moon hunters) and the historical novel ( Meister Joachims Secret and Die alte Mühl ).

Sigrid Heuck received a. a. The following awards: 1984 the Friedrich Gerstäcker Prize for moon hunters , 1988 the Fantastic Prize of the City of Wetzlar for Said's story , 1990 the Austrian Youth Book Prize for Master Joachim's Secret and the Grand Prize of the German Academy for Children's and Youth Literature for their complete works, 1994 the Bavarian Order of Merit and in 2002 the Federal Cross of Merit, First Class. Her books were also on the shortlist for the German Youth Literature Prize six times .

Heuck died on October 2, 2014 in Bad Tölz, Upper Bavaria, at the age of 82.

The artistic estate of the writer and illustrator Sigrid Heuck was handed over to the children's and youth book department of the Berlin State Library - Prussian Cultural Heritage for permanent storage.
